Chanel BoyLil Uzi Vert

Hailing from Philadelphia and commanding massive support from young fans as a charismatic emo-rap figure, Lil Uzi Vert is in the spotlight again.
The work he released in November 2025 is Chanel Boy.
As his first drop after leaving the label he’d been with for years and going independent, this track blends spacey synths reminiscent of the Eternal Atake era with heavy trap beats for an addictive result.
The lyrics depict an obsession with luxury brands and a lifestyle so lavish it makes him forget to eat or sleep, radiating the confidence of someone who’s made it.
It’s the perfect song for when you’re feeling fashionable or want to elevate a stylish late-night drive.
G-ANNIS FREESTYLEMAVI

MAVI, an intellectual rapper from South Carolina now based in Charlotte, North Carolina, has a unique background—he studied neuroscience at Howard University—and has long impressed heads with philosophical lyrics over soulful beats.
In November 2025, he dropped a mixtape titled “The Pilot.” Let me introduce a standout, self-assured track from it.
In just two and a half minutes, he delivers his most aggressive, razor-sharp rapping yet, likening his own skills to the dominance of NBA star Giannis Antetokounmpo.
Blending the clarity gained from sobriety with raw street energy, this release is a treat for anyone who craves both lyrical heft and irresistible groove.
The House That Doesn’t ExistMelody’s Echo Chamber

Melody’s Echo Chamber is the solo project led by French musician Melody Prochet.
With its psychedelic weightlessness and sweet vocals, it has secured a solid place in the dream-pop scene.
Her new track is The House That Doesn’t Exist.
Serving as the opener to her fourth album, Unclouded, due out on December 5, 2025, the song is striking for its elegant sound, with strings that seem to soar.
Its worldview invites you into a fantastical space—a “house that doesn’t exist”—making it perfect for moments when you want to step away from reality and rest your mind.
Co-created with Sven Wunder, the music offers a cinematic soundscape to sink into, so if you’re looking for something to play on a quiet night, be sure to check it out.
DisconnectedMichael Monroe

Michael Monroe, the living legend from Finland and former frontman of Hanoi Rocks.
With a unique style forged through glam rock and punk and a commanding stage presence, he has led the global rock scene for over 40 years.
From his upcoming album Outerstellar, slated for release in February 2026, he has pre-released this track.
While addressing themes of loneliness and division brought on by technology, it’s an anthem that belts out a sense of unity with a catchy chorus tailor-made for live shows.
Dropped right after his Japan shows in November 2025, this release is a triumph, bursting with a powerful band sound crafted alongside longtime comrades.
For anyone whose soul longs to feel real rock’n’roll in the flesh—not just through a screen—this song will hit home, without a doubt.
Hello RevengeNLE The Great

Hailing from Memphis, NLE Choppa has rebranded himself as NLE the Great starting in 2025, opening a new chapter.
He balances spiritual awakening with aggressive rap, and this track is a powerful number that includes a diss aimed at his longtime rival, NBA YoungBoy.
Over a cinematic beat where stormy pianos intertwine with heavy drums, his lyrics stand out as a declaration not only of revenge but of personal rebirth and resolve.
Released in November 2025, the song has stirred the scene as the third installment in a rapid-fire series of diss tracks.
The music video’s ritualistic imagery quoting the Bible also drew attention.
If you’re into high-tension drill and trap, or you’re a head following the twists of street beefs, this one’s a must-listen.
